Abstract

Internet of Things (IoT) adoption grows in numerous industries, cyber-security threats utilising low-cost end-user devices increase, compromising IoT implementation in a variety of situations. To solve this issue, developing Software Defined Networking (SDN) and Network Function Virtualization (NFV)bring new safety accelerators, providing IoT network systems with the versatility needed to deal with theIoT security deployments. Here, honeynets may be strengthened with support for SDN and NFV, allowing them to be used in IoT applications and boosting security. They provide service for virtualization that replicate the setup of actual IoT networks so that intruders might be diverted from their intended target.
